Raptor是一个开源C库,提供了一套解析器和序列化器来产生资源描述框架(RDF)triples,通过解析语法或序列化triples到一个语法。该解析器支持RDF/XML、N-">Triples、GRDDL 和 Turtle,并通过RSS标记,包含:XML RSS、ATOM0.3和Atom 1.0。该序列化器支持RDF/XML(3款),Turtle,DOT,N-Triples,RSS 1.0 和 Atom 1.0。Raptor用于处理RDF/XML中使用RDF应用,如RSS 1.0,FOAF,DOAP,Dublin Core和OWL,它可以使用XML解析的expat或libxml2,支持移植到多个POSIX系统。
Raptor RDF Syntax Library 2.0.5该版本更新日志:
1.所有的解析器和序列化器已升级到使用W3C格式的URIs作为主要的URI。
2.修复了N-Quads解析器处理一个可选的上下文/图URI的问题,这样就可以读取所有的N-Triples。
3.Turtle序列使用正式text/turtle 的MIME类型。
4.添加一些额外的UTF-8和snprintf函数。
5.不再需要数学函数TRUNC,lround和round。
6.几个内部的代码风格已修复和清理。
7.修复了报告的问题:0000465,0000476,0000479和0000481。
软件信息:http://librdf.org/raptor/
下载地址:http://download.librdf.org/source/raptor2-2.0.5.tar.gz
时间: 2024-09-08 19:23:32